About

Yusen Qin is a robotics researcher whose work bridges the gap between academic SLAM research and real-world autonomous navigation. His key contributions center on visual place recognition and simultaneous localization and mapping (SLAM) for practical applications, particularly in last-mile delivery robotics. His most cited work, the "Segway DRIVE Benchmark" (2019, 8 citations), introduced a unique dataset collected by a fleet of delivery robots operating in authentic urban environments. This benchmark directly addresses a critical limitation in the field: most existing SLAM datasets are captured under idealized conditions, failing to represent the challenges of in situ operations such as dynamic obstacles, varying lighting, and repetitive visual features. By providing data from actual food delivery runs, Qin's work enables researchers to develop and evaluate algorithms that are robust to real-world deployment scenarios. His research thus serves as a vital bridge, helping to translate theoretical advances in visual SLAM into practical, reliable navigation for autonomous delivery systems.
